Abstract:
The site grid was laid out using a Trimble VRS differential Global Positioning System (Trimble R6 model). The survey was undertaken using Bartington Grad601 magnetic gradiometers. These were employed taking readings at 0.25m intervals on zig-zag traverses 1.0m apart within 30m by 30m grids, so that 3600 readings were recorded in each grid. These readings were stored in the memory of the instrument and later downloaded to computer for processing and interpretation. A geophysical (magnetometer) survey was undertaken on approximately 4.4 hectares of land located to the north of Foxdenton Road, Foxdenton, Oldham, Greater Manchester. Anomalies associated with 18th century buildings have been recorded along with former field boundaries. Magnetic disturbance relate to metal fencing within the boundaries and adjacent roads/tracks. A service pipe has also been recorded. Geological anomalies have been recorded throughout due to variations within the sandy soils. No anomalies of an early archaeological origin have been recorded.
